Welcome to North Houston ...
North Houston is located on the Gulf Coast.
North Houston is located in Harris County<1>.
While we don't have a date for the founding of North Houston, you might consider that their post office opened in 1910.
A typical abbreviation for North Houston: N. Houston
North Houston is 110 feet [34 m] above sea level.<2>.
Time Zone: North Houston lies in the Central Time Zone (CST/CDT) and observes daylight saving time
Area Codes for North Houston: 713, 281, 346 & 832<3>
The ZIP code for North Houston: 77315<4>

Adding North Houston to Our Gazetteer ...
We originally found mention of North Houston in both the FIPS-55 and the GNIS. For more information, see the FIPS and GNIS Codes sections on our Miscellaneous Page.
From our notes, the earliest published mention we've found (so far) for North Houston was in the document titled List of Post Offices from Cameron Blevins and Richard Helbock.<6>
From that list, the North Houston post office opened in 1910. The North Houston post office closed in 1928.

| <3> | When there's a risk of an area code running out of phone numbers, an 'Overlay Area Code' is created that has the same geographic boundaries as the existing area code. In this case, the 713 code has been Overlayed with one of the following codes: 281, 346 or 832. New phone numbers in the North Houston area will be assigned with one of these codes: 713, 281, 346 or 832. As a result, placing a call in the North Houston area will require 10-digit dialing (where you enter both the area code and then the phone number). |
